O kraju i mieście
Mauritius is a tropical island in the Indian Ocean about 2,000 km off the east coast of Africa, famed for white-sand beaches, turquoise lagoons fringed by coral reefs and a unique multicultural blend of Indian, Creole, Chinese and French traditions.

Atrakcje i miejsca historyczne
- Aapravasi Ghat (UNESCO) is a 19th-century memorial through which nearly half a million Indian indentured labourers passed.
- The Port Louis Central Market is a two-storey market of spices, tropical fruit, fish and souvenirs in the heart of the city.
- The Caudan Waterfront is a modern complex of restaurants, shops and a casino on the harbour.
- Fort Adelaide (the Citadel) is a 19th-century British fort on a hilltop with panoramic views of the harbour.
Muzea
- The Blue Penny Museum is the main home of the two legendary 1847 'Blue Mauritius' and 'Red Mauritius' postage stamps.
- The Natural History Museum holds the world's only complete skeleton of the extinct dodo, Mauritius's symbol.
- The Mauritius Photography Museum is a private collection of historical photographs of the island from the 19th century onward.
Gdzie spędzić czas
- Stroll across Place d'Armes, the main colonial-era square lined with palms and overlooked by the Government House.
- Port Louis Chinatown is a Chinese quarter with pagodas, a market and dim sum restaurants.
- Dine with harbour views at the Caudan Waterfront and shop for local crafts at the Craft Market.
Kuchnia lokalna
Try street-side dholl puri with curry and a glass of alouda at the central market — the most authentic taste of Mauritius.
